The TPS6222x devices are a family of high-efficiency,
synchronous step-down converters ideally suited for
portable systems powered by 1-cell Li-Ion or 3-cell
NiMH/NiCd batteries. The devices are also suitable to
operate from a standard 3.3-V or 5-V voltage rail.

With an output voltage range of 6 V down to 0.7 V
and up to 400-mA output current, the devices are
ideal for powering the low voltage TMS320™ DSP
family and processors used in PDAs, pocket PCs,
and smart phones. Under nominal load current, the
devices operate with a fixed switching frequency of
typically 1.25 MHz. At light load currents, the part
enters the power-save mode operation; the switching
frequency is reduced and the quiescent current is
typically only 15 µA; therefore, the device achieves
the highest efficiency over the entire load current
range. The TPS6222x needs only three small
external components. Together with the tiny TSOT23
package, a minimum system solution size can be
achieved. An advanced fast response voltage mode
control scheme achieves superior line and load
regulation with small ceramic input and output
capacitors.
